Coffee powdering mechanism and coffee machine Technical Field The disclosure relates to the technical field of coffee machines, and in particular relates to a coffee powdering device and a coffee machine. Background At present, along with the continuous improvement of the living standard of people, the enthusiasm of people for coffee culture is also continuously rising. In recent years, with the continuous rise of coffee culture, some tools related to coffee are also emerged. For example, coffee powder dispensers are popular with coffee people. In the field of coffee, a powder scattering cup is used as a core tool for uniformly scattering coffee powder, the structural stability and operability of the powder scattering cup directly influence the quality of coffee and the experience of a user, and a traditional coffee powder scattering device generally adopts a mechanical fixing mode and uses a buckle to fix a filter screen or a cup plug and the like. Such designs have significant drawbacks in practical applications. When the filter screen in the dusting cup needs to be replaced, the filter screen can be fixed with the cup plug in a mode of being connected with threads through a buckle, manual disassembly and realignment installation are needed, a large number of complicated processes are needed in the installation process, and the filter screen is difficult to replace according to different requirements. Disclosure of utility model The aim of the present disclosure is to overcome the disadvantages of the prior art and to provide a coffee powdering device and a coffee machine which can be replaced by a magnetic filter screen. The aim of the disclosure is achieved by the following technical scheme: A coffee powdering mechanism is characterized by comprising a cup body, a cup cover, a filter screen, a cup plug assembly and a first magnetic attraction piece, wherein the cup body is provided with a containing cavity, the containing cavity is used for containing coffee powder, the cup cover is connected to the end portion of the cup body, an inner boss is convexly arranged in the inner cavity of the cup cover, one side, close to the end portion of the cup body, of the inner boss is provided with a magnetic attraction surface, the first magnetic attraction piece is arranged on the magnetic attraction surface, the filter screen is arranged between the cup body and the cup cover, the filter screen is connected to the first magnetic attraction piece and is attached to the magnetic attraction surface, the containing cavity is communicated with a filtering hole of the filter screen, a powder outlet is formed in the cup cover, the powder outlet is communicated with the containing cavity, the cup plug assembly is arranged at the powder outlet, the cup plug assembly is provided with an adsorption part, and the adsorption part is magnetically attracted and connected to the filter screen. In one embodiment, the number of the first magnetic attraction pieces is multiple, the magnetic attraction surface is provided with multiple first grooves, and each first magnetic attraction piece is correspondingly arranged in a corresponding first groove. In one embodiment, the cup plug assembly comprises a cup plug body and a plurality of second magnetic attraction pieces, the adsorption part is arranged on one side, close to the cup cover, of the cup plug body, the adsorption part penetrates through the powder discharging opening, a plurality of second grooves are formed in the end face of the adsorption part, and each second magnetic attraction piece is correspondingly arranged in the corresponding second groove. In one embodiment, the cup is removably attached to the cap. In one embodiment, the cup body is provided with an external thread, the external thread is located at one end of the cup body, which is close to the cup cover, the cup cover is provided with an internal thread, and the external thread is connected with the internal thread in a matched manner. In one embodiment, a plurality of first grooves are annularly arranged at intervals along the magnetic attraction surface, and the distance between one first groove and two adjacent first grooves is equal, and/or, The second grooves are arranged at intervals in a ring shape along the end face of the adsorption part, and the distance between one second groove and two adjacent second grooves is equal. In one embodiment, the filter screen is detachably magnetically attracted to the magnetic attraction surface. In one embodiment, the cup plug body is provided with a first poking port and a second poking port, and the first poking port and the second poking port are oppositely arranged on the peripheral wall of the cup plug body.
